WebMASH (Originaltitel: MASH – A Novel About Three Army Doctors) ist ein satirischer Antikriegsroman von Richard Hooker, der als Vorlage für den Spielfilm M*A*S*H sowie … MASH: A Novel About Three Army Doctors is a 1968 novel written by Richard Hooker (the pen name of former military surgeon H. Richard Hornberger) with the assistance of writer W. C. Heinz. It is notable as the foundation of the M*A*S*H franchise, which includes a 1970 feature film and a long-running TV … Ver más Hornberger was born in 1924 and raised in Trenton, New Jersey. He attended Bowdoin College in Brunswick, Maine.
